Cayuga County Legislature Chairman Jonathan Anna says that quote “all options” are being considered for the shuttered office building.
The Citizen reports those options include demolishing the existing structure and constructing a new facility.
The building in Auburn has been closed since May after asbestos-containing vermiculite was found in the upper floors.
Last September, it was announced the building would remain closed for two years. County departments were forced to move to temporary locations amid the closure.
Anna made the remarks yesterday during his State of the County address.
